Marketing Technologies Business Product Owner Marketing Automation

Roche

Not Interested
Bookmark
Report This Job

profile Job Location:

Basel - Switzerland

profile Monthly Salary: Not Disclosed
Posted on: 12 hours ago
Vacancies: 1 Vacancy

Job Summary

At Roche you can show up as yourself embraced for the unique qualities you bring. Our culture encourages personal expression open dialogue and genuine connections where you are valued accepted and respected for who you are allowing you to thrive both personally and professionally. This is how we aim to prevent stop and cure diseases and ensure everyone has access to healthcare today and for generations to come. Join Roche where every voice matters.

The Position

Are you a MarTech expert who thrives on turning complex business visions into tangible digital reality

At Roche we are building a harmonized world-class customer engagement ecosystem. As our MarTech Product Owner you will be the heartbeat of an Agile Release Train (ART). You will sit at the intersection of business strategy and technical execution translating the Big Picture roadmap into high-impact user stories that empower our global affiliates and enhance the lives of patients worldwide.

The Opportunity

  • Execute the Roadmap: Translate global marketing strategy features into well-defined user stories and prioritized backlogs that drive value across the enterprise.

  • Lead the ART: Act as the primary business SME within the Agile Release Train collaborating with Roche Digital Technologies (IT) and external vendors to ensure flawless product delivery.

  • Champion Innovation: Proactively identify opportunities for AI and automation to evolve our Marketing Strategy capabilities.

  • Drive Adoption: Own the end-to-end lifecycle of your productfrom initial process design and SOP creation to global roll-out training and KPI tracking.

  • Global Collaboration: Work across boundaries to align with Solution Owners ensuring your product integrates seamlessly into the wider Roche MarTech ecosystem.

Who you are

You are a VACC leader (Visionary Architect Catalyst Coach) who is comfortable navigating a decentralized global environment. You know how to synthesize complex technical topics into compelling narratives.

  • Industry Core: 5 years of experience in Pharma/Biotech with deep expertise in Marketing Strategy domains.

  • Transformation Track Record: 5 years in large-scale international technology transformations.

  • Agile Expertise: Proven experience as a Product Owner in Scaled Agile (SAFe) or DevOps environments.

  • Platform Fluency: Hands-on experience with CRM and Marketing Automation ecosystems (e.g. Salesforce Marketing Cloud Adobe Veeva).

  • Lean Mindset: Expertise in applying Lean methodologies (Six Sigma/Kaizen) to optimize business processes.

  • Communication: Exceptional English skills with the ability to facilitate difficult conversations and build trust with diverse stakeholders.

  • Education: University degree required (MBA or related graduate degree is a plus).

  • Travel: Ability to travel globally 20% of the time.

Ready for the next step We look forward to hearing from you. Apply now to discover this exciting opportunity!

Who we are

A healthier future drives us to innovate. Together more than 100000 employees across the globe are dedicated to advance science ensuring everyone has access to healthcare today and for generations to come. Our efforts result in more than 26 million people treated with our medicines and over 30 billion tests conducted using our Diagnostics products. We empower each other to explore new possibilities foster creativity and keep our ambitions high so we can deliver life-changing healthcare solutions that make a global impact.


Lets build a healthier future together.

Roche is an Equal Opportunity Employer.

At Roche you can show up as yourself embraced for the unique qualities you bring. Our culture encourages personal expression open dialogue and genuine connections where you are valued accepted and respected for who you are allowing you to thrive both personally and professionally. This is how we aim...
View more view more

Key Skills

  • Conveyancing Paralegal
  • Fireworks
  • Logistics
  • Clinical
  • Avionics

About Company

F. Hoffmann-La Roche AG is a Swiss multinational healthcare company that operates worldwide under two divisions: Pharmaceuticals and Diagnostics. Its holding company, Roche Holding AG, has bearer shares listed on the SIX Swiss Exchange. The company headquarters are located in Basel.

View Profile View Profile